震级一频度曲线呈系统性起伏的可能性及影响

摘    要:自从对全球而言的古登堡—里克特关系:lgN(m)=a-bm,被推广应用于各具体的地震区带的地震活动性研究以来,有成功的例子,有艰难但仍获解释的例子,也有谨慎但论据充足的反例。其实,对于第二种情况而言,也未必就不是反例。本文拟从数学反证的角度,证明对于具体的地震区带而言,其震级-频度曲线呈现系统性起伏是可能的。考虑到震级-频度曲线在短临预报和中长期预报中应用广泛,本文还简要评述了如果忽视其系统性起伏可能导致的后果。

SYSTEMATIC FLUCTUATION OF MAGNITUDE-FREQUENCY CURVE: POSSIBILITY AND INFLUENCE

Abstract:Since the Gutenberg-Richter relation(logN(m) =a-bm)which had been established for worldwide data was spread and applied in studying seismicities on different seismic areas or zones, there have been a number of successful examples,hard but grudgingly explicable examples and reverse examples with prudential and ample evidence. Actually,it is afraid that the second case might be reverse examples. In the light of reductio ad absurdum on mathematics this paper tries to testify that the systematic fluctuation in magnitude-frequency curve is possible for specific seismic zones. Considering spreading application of the magnitude-frequency curve on middle and long-term to shor-term predictions,briefly this paper discusses possible results caused by overlooking the systematic fluctuation.
